WebAug 15, 2016 · Flame spread ratings (FSR’s) are expressed as a number on a continuous scale where inorganic reinforced cement board is 0 and red oak is 100. The scale is divided into classes. The most commonly used flame-spread classifications are: Class I or A, with a 0-25 FSR Class II or B with a 26-75 FSR Class III or C with a 76-200 FSR http://www.lasfm.org/doc_flamespread.html
